if u cannot see why 1 guardian is better then 2 h . sw ,ill try to explain .There is one minor almost irrelevant thingie called upkeep .For same amount of gold u can maintain 3 guardians instead 4 heavy swordsman.Upkeep is more expensive part  then training cost of  a unit (in normal circumstances aka u are not  a retard to lose soldiers all soldiers few days after training ) . Upkeep margin which u can pay with ur goldmine "skill" and economy determines size of ur army .

Not to mention the fact that you need 20k more population to build 40k heavy swordmen than 20k guardians, which means you have 20k less people producing resources = less gold.

Shall I also mention that the number of soldiers attacking a fortress is limited by the physical boundaries of the fortress? Therefore, the most powerful each of the soldiers attacking, the less time it will take you to destroy the fortress (= the less troops you will lose against the enemy archers....even can make the difference of winning or losing the attack if you are tight on morale on that attack).

Quote
"How does the population grow?

The population has fixed growth of 30 people per hour, plus 1 for every 1000 population, 1 for every Granary. "

However after 100 000 the population growth starts to slow down:

at 100 000 after the calculation of the growth formula we take 10 population out, so you have (30+100+Granaries)*terrain*medicine-10..
at 110 000 we take 24 out (this is 10 + 14)
at 120 000 we take 42 out (this is 10+14+18)
and so on.... every 10 000 above 100 000 adds:
10 at 100k
14 (10+4) at 110k
18 (14+4)
22 (18+4)
26 (22+4)
30 (26+4) at 150k
and so on...

So at 150 000 population we are subtracting from the hourly growth the sum of 10+14+18+22+26+30=120 ... soon the growth will seize... medicine and granaries can push the absolute barrier but inevitably the growth will stop."
